The Siemens 6ES5581-0ED13 provides the foundation for fault-tolerant S5 controller configurations. This basic module measures 250 mm in depth and 25 mm in width. It fits standard SIMATIC S5 rack slots without any modifications. The unit weighs 0.48 kg, making installation quick and straightforward.
Redundancy Architecture and Failover Function
This basic module manages automatic switchover between two central processing units. The Siemens 6ES5581-0ED13 monitors the primary CPU’s health every 500 milliseconds. It initiates a bumpless transfer to the backup CPU within 100 milliseconds. The module compares critical data between both processors continuously. It logs all failover events with time stamps for diagnostic purposes.
Internal Architecture and Component Layout
The module contains three separate circuit boards inside its metal housing. One board handles failover logic, while another manages data comparison. The third board provides isolated communication paths between CPUs. The Siemens 6ES5581-0ED13 includes a dedicated 16-bit microcontroller for redundancy management. A 48-pin edge connector interfaces with the S5 backplane for power and data. The module stores 150 µF of capacitance for power supply filtering only.
Interface Connections and Status Indicators
You will find two 20-pin connectors on the front panel for inter-CPU links. The Siemens 6ES5581-0ED13 provides LED indicators for primary, backup, and active status. Four diagnostic LEDs show synchronization, fault, and test mode conditions. The module outputs relay contacts for external alarm and status indication. It also provides a serial diagnostic port for system monitoring.
Power Requirements and Environmental Tolerance
The Siemens 6ES5581-0ED13 draws 120 mA at 5V DC from the backplane supply. It requires no external 24V DC power for its internal circuits. The module operates reliably from 0°C to 60°C ambient temperature. It tolerates humidity levels up to 95 percent without any condensation issues. The unit withstands vibration up to 2g from 10 to 500 Hz.

The Siemens 6ES5581-0ED13 replaces older redundancy modules in S5-135U and S5-155U systems. You need two CPUs and one cable for a complete redundant pair. This module also supports manual switchover for maintenance without process interruption. Consequently, it provides fault-tolerant control for power plants and chemical processes.
